- Description
- This was a retrospective clinical study of 100 metastatic colorectal cancer patients who received FOLFOX (oxaliplatin + 5-fluorouracil + folinic acid) first-line therapy alone or with monoclonal antibodies (bevacizumab or cetuximab). It assessed the relationship between BRAF mutation status in primary tumors and response to oxaliplatin-based first-line therapy, as measured by post treatment PFS. Of 100 patients, 94 had wildtype BRAF and 6 had mutations in BRAF—including V600E and D594K. The study found that patients harboring a BRAF mutation were significantly more resistant to oxaliplatin-based first-line therapy than patients with wildtype BRAF (Median PFS: 5.0 and 11. 7 months, respectively; p < .0001).
